Would you like to see the pedigree for a horse?
Our "Premium Edited Pedigree" (Report No. 40), includes the best runners in a horse's family in catalogue-style format.
Our basic 5-generation pedigree (No. 10) shows the names of the sires and dams back through 5 generations.
|
Would you like to find out the Race Record for a Horse?
We suggest a Lifetime Starts (Report No. 9) which is formatted like a Past Performance. Or if you'd prefer only a summary record,
we recommend a Tabulated Race Record (Report No. 12).
|
Would you like to find out about what a mare has produced and what her foals have done on the track?
We suggest a Mare's Produce Record w/Race Records for each foal (Report No. 21).
|
Would you like to find out about a stallion and what his foals have done on the track?
We suggest either a Sire's Crop Analysis Report (Report No. 33) or a Sire's Top Foals (Report No. 31). Both will provide you
with summary race records for the foals. The No. 33 shows you all the stallion's foals, while the No. 31 just shows you the stallion's top foals.
|
Are you wondering what stallion crosses well with your mare?
Our "Nicking Report for a
mare (Report No. 91)" includes statistics on which crosses have produced successful runners.
|
Would you like to know what crosses have worked well with a particular stallion?
Our "Nicking Report for a Sire" (Report No. 92) includes statistics on which broodmare sire crosses have produced successful runners.
